
New Delhi, December 31, 2025: Housing and Urban Development Corporation Limited (HUDCO) reported strong business momentum during the nine months ended December 31, 2025, with cumulative loan sanctions reaching ₹1,39,151.92 crore.
Strong Loan Sanctions Momentum
During the third quarter of FY26 alone, HUDCO achieved loan sanctions of ₹46,167.32 crore, contributing significantly to the overall nine-month performance. The steady pace of sanctions reflects continued demand across housing and urban infrastructure financing segments.Disbursements Maintain Healthy Trajectory
Loan disbursements for the nine-month period stood at ₹41,346.70 crore. In Q3 FY26, disbursements amounted to ₹15,508.25 crore, indicating sustained execution and fund deployment during the quarter.Loan Performance Snapshot
| Particulars | Q3 FY26 (₹ crore) | 9M FY26 (₹ crore) |
|---|---|---|
| Loan Sanctions | 46,167.32 | 1,39,151.92 |
| Loan Disbursements | 15,508.25 | 41,346.70 |
About the Company
Housing and Urban Development Corporation Limited is a Government of India enterprise engaged in financing housing and urban infrastructure projects.
